I am a grand adventurer who has traveled to nearly fifty countries and visited 36 United States and territories. I have cross country skied in the arctic circle from Russia to Finland to Norway. I have ridden a horse in the streets of Moscow and gone wakeboarding in the Red Square. I have ridden a camel in India during a two-month journey across the country. I have worn a tuxedo in the middle of the South Pacific Ocean on Easter Island. I have surfed in Indonesia. I have dressed in lederhosen to drink beer with the Germans in Munich on the opening day of Oktoberfest. Above all, I am a sensitive and empathetic artist who loves to paint, draw, sculpt, make music, dance and express myself through various other art forms of which acting is my absolute favorite. Acting is life. I was a student at the DFAS Acting School in Atlanta and then at AMAW in Hollywood for nearly three years. I am back taking classes at LS Studios in Atlanta. My passion in life, my calling is acting. My purpose in life is understanding humanity and telling stories through art.
